Output 8a70a43d00e196e5d193152d4219f3a74aad07918e13e6acde8b88861a13894b:1

value
308833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b329958367f24a427034dba411cdf1ea6a2d8ec2 OP_EQUAL
address
3J2LhC2S1oeaHCzKTP2tBZaCmNQNxczRAT
transaction
8a70a43d00e196e5d193152d4219f3a74aad07918e13e6acde8b88861a13894b
confirmations
183053
spent
true